    Cardiac Arrest (Sudden Cardiac Death)

    Definition
    Cardiac arrest means the heart suddenly stops pumping. When the heart stops, the victim will also stop breathing resulting in sudden death.

    HEART ATTACK

    Definition
    Heart attack or acute myocardial infarction occurs when a blood clot suddenly and completely blocks a diseased coronary artery. There is no blood supply resulting in the death of the heart muscle cells supplied by that artery.

    Foreign-Body Airway Obstruction (Choking)

    Definition
    Choking occurs when food especially a piece of meat or other foreign object such as a marble, a button gets lodged in the windpipe. When someone is choking, there is either a PARTIAL or a COMPLETE airway obstruction.
